Quick Troubleshooting of Short Circuits in Distribution Boxes

Short circuits in distribution boxes are typically caused by damaged insulation, loose connections, or faulty components, and can be diagnosed using systematic inspection and voltage testing.Initial Safety MeasuresBefore troubleshooting, turn off the main power supply to prevent electric shock. Use insulated tools and wear protective equipment. Never attempt to inspect live circuits without proper precautions.Common Causes of Short CircuitsDamaged Wiring or Insulation: Wires with frayed insulation or cuts can allow hot and neutral wires to touch, causing a short circuit .Loose or Improper Connections: Loose screws or improperly seated wires in DIN terminals or breakers can create unintended contact points .Overloaded Circuits: Excessive load on a single circuit can stress wiring and components, sometimes leading to shorts .Poor Grounding: Inadequate grounding can cause leakage currents and short circuits, especially in damp or humid environments .Environmental Factors: Moisture, dust, pests, or vibration can damage insulation or components, triggering shorts .Faulty Components: Aging breakers, sensors, or other devices may fail internally, causing immediate trips or sparks .Step-by-Step TroubleshootingVisual Inspection: Check all wires, terminals, and components for visible damage, discoloration, or burn marks .Check Breakers: Ensure breakers are in the ON position and not worn out. Replace any that trip immediately without load .Test Voltage: Use a multimeter to measure voltage at the power supply, distribution box, and individual circuits. Look for unexpected drops or shorts .Isolate Circuits: Disconnect all loads and test each circuit individually. Reconnect devices one by one to identify the faulty component .Inspect Connections: Tighten all screws and ensure wires are properly seated in terminals. Avoid clamping insulation instead of the conductor .Check Grounding: Verify that the distribution box and circuits are properly grounded to prevent leakage currents .Replace Damaged Components: Replace any frayed wires, faulty breakers, or damaged devices to restore safe operation .Preventive MeasuresSchedule regular inspections and maintenance to detect wear or loose connections early .Keep the distribution box clean and dry to prevent environmental damage .Avoid overloading circuits and ensure proper wire gauge for long cable runs to minimize voltage drop .Use quality components and replace aging breakers or sensors proactively . By following these steps, you can systematically identify and resolve short circuits in distribution boxes, ensuring safe and reliable electrical operation.
